Who's Monte Miller?

 

Monte arrived in Coeur d'Alene as a boy in 1963 and never left, except for college at the University of Idaho. An architect, he's a partner in Miller Stauffer Architects.

 

Eating out is a treat for the busy Monte Miller family so they go where they know both parents and kids anticipate a scrumptious meal and always leave happy.

"They're proud of their burgers and they should be," Monte says. "They're the best. A Double D burger, large fries and a huckleberry shake - yum."

Roger's Ice Cream & Burgers has grown into a Coeur d'Alene institution since 1940 despite different owners and a move from downtown. Its sinfully rich ice cream mixed with candy bar pieces, cookie dough, gum balls, huckleberries and more, draws crowds all summer long. People not waiting for waffle cones of Moose Tracks or Caramel Caribou ice cream wait for juicy double cheeseburgers thick with pickles, tomato slices and nose-clearing onion.

Roger's works perfectly for the Miller family after Little League games. The walk-up order window and outdoor picnic table seating require no more personal preparation than washing hands. A slow, steady stream of cars along Sherman Avenue mutes sidewalk noise, so the Millers can boisterously relive baseball games while they eat with no worries about disturbing other diners.

Roger's attracts people of every age and style. Grandparents wait in line with teens in sagging board shorts, sharing their passion for chili fries, the 44-Calibre burger and even the Garden burger.
